NetworkManager (since 1.0.6) exposes the information whether a connection is metered. See https://blogs.gnome.org/lkundrak/2015/08/27/networkmanager-1-0-6-brings-metered-connections-api-and-more/ This can be set explicitly by the user, e.g. for a WiFi connection. Maybe u-a could query that information? That said, I read Steve's proposal to install u-a only for cloud-images.
